EWN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2019 in Review

56 of the 4,560 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ares MSCI Netherlands ETF (EWN) for Q3 2019, worth a combined $71.3M — down 25% from $94.9M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 13 funds closed out of EWN and 7 opened new positions — a net loss of 6 holders — while 25 trimmed existing stakes and 15 added.

The largest buyer was Wells Fargo, adding an estimated $8.55M. The largest seller was Jane Street, exiting entirely with an estimated $10M sold.
